What Exactly Is a CLB3000A Wall Bushing?

Let's cut through the jargon first. The CLB3000A isn't some sci-fi gadget - it's the workhorse of power substations. Imagine a heavy-duty traffic cop directing 3000 amps of electricity through concrete walls without breaking a sweat. This aluminum-conductor wall bushing acts like a VIP tunnel for high-voltage currents in 20KV systems, keeping power flowing smoothly between switchgear compartments.

Code Breakdown: Cracking the Alphanumeric Cipher

  • C = Indoor installation
  • L = Aluminum conductor (the lightweight champion of conductivity)
  • B = Reinforced mechanical strength (think "bodybuilder" version)
  • 3000A = Current rating (enough to power 300+ American households simultaneously)
  • 20KV = Voltage capacity (handles lightning-like 20,000 volts)

Where These Electrical Superheroes Operate

You'll find CLB3000A units playing crucial roles in:

  • Transformer substations (the power grid's version of airport hubs)
  • Industrial switchgear (like bouncers controlling electricity flow)
  • High-voltage capacitor banks (the power system's rechargeable batteries)

Recent industry data shows a 12% annual growth in wall bushing demand, driven by global grid modernization projects. A 2024 Zhejiang Power Authority study revealed these components prevent 73% of substation wall penetration failures.

Technical Sweet Spot: Why 3000A Matters

This current rating hits the Goldilocks zone for modern power systems:

  • Handles peak industrial loads without breaking stride
  • Maintains stable operation between -40°C to +80°C (from Arctic cold to desert heat)
  • Features dual-layer silicone rubber insulation - the electrical equivalent of bulletproof glass

Installation Pro Tip:

Always pair with CR-9522 conductive paste - it's like putting premium sunscreen on electrical contacts. Skipping this step? That's how you get "hot spots" (and not the good Wi-Fi kind).
